Summary

The Indiana Fever defeated the Seattle Storm, 105-95, on July 28, improving to 18-10 on the season. After their strong performances, neither Caitlin Clark nor Sophie Cunningham addressed media questions regarding Cunningham's controversial comments about trans athletes. A rally in support of Cunningham preceded the game, leading to criticism of both players for avoiding the issue during the postgame interview. A Fever spokesperson stated that neither the team nor Cunningham was aware of the rally's organization. The situation continues to garner significant attention as fans express frustration over the lack of accountability from Clark and Cunningham.
